We are pleased to announce the release of OMF version 5.4!

This release has many changes under the hood, but only few changes to the OEDL syntax.

Among the things that have been added or fixed are:

  • Communication between AM and EC now happens over XMPP. For compatibility reasons the AM still provides a HTTP interface for all services.
  • "omf stat" and "omf tell" are working with the latest CMC service
  • support for "ath9k" Wifi driver and Intel WiMAX cards
  • the RC can now download files from FTP servers
  • when loading a disk image, it can be grown to the actual disk size and shrunk before saving it. This allows the users to make use of the full HDD space as well as provides compatibility for testbeds with mixed disk sizes.
  • the "all" topology is available again
  • improved the status report after disk imaging
  • the EC can now "give up" on nodes that don't sign in for any experiment

Note: You can run the OMF 5.4 EC and RC alongside older versions of OMF. However we currently do not recommend running the OMF 5.4 and 5.3 AMs on the same XMPP server, since they both try to answer to service calls which may lead to some problems.
